The Camel Company produces 10,000 units of item Roto 454 annually at a total cost of $190,000.
The Yukon Company has offered to supply 10,000 units of Roto 454 per year for $18 per unit. If Camel accepts the offer, $4 per unit of the fixed overhead would be saved. In addition, some of Camel's facilities could be rented to a third party for $15,000 per year.
-At what price would Camel be indifferent to Yukon's offer?
A) $17.00.
B) $17.50.
C) $18.50.
D) $19.50.
